diff --git a/lambdas/cis2-api/package.json b/lambdas/cis2-api/package.json index 8e3400db..d2589d4d 100644 --- a/lambdas/cis2-api/package.json +++ b/lambdas/cis2-api/package.json @@ -26,6 +26,6 @@ "date-fns": "^4.1.0", "jwt-decode": "^4.0.0", "winston": "^3.17.0", - "zod": "^3.24.2" + "zod": "^4.0.10" } } diff --git a/lambdas/jwks-key-rotation/package.json b/lambdas/jwks-key-rotation/package.json index fc889984..1fd63a40 100644 --- a/lambdas/jwks-key-rotation/package.json +++ b/lambdas/jwks-key-rotation/package.json @@ -27,6 +27,6 @@ "@types/node-jose": "^1.1.13", "node-jose": "^2.2.0", "winston": "^3.14.2", - "zod": "^3.24.2" + "zod": "^4.0.10" } } diff --git a/package-lock.json b/package-lock.json index e0d3fc75..c4b87e5b 100644 --- a/package-lock.json +++ b/package-lock.json @@ -114,7 +114,7 @@ "date-fns": "^4.1.0", "jwt-decode": "^4.0.0", "winston": "^3.17.0", - "zod": "^3.24.2" + "zod": "^4.0.10" }, "devDependencies": { "@types/aws-lambda": "^8.10.148", @@ -160,7 +160,7 @@ "@types/node-jose": "^1.1.13", "node-jose": "^2.2.0", "winston": "^3.14.2", - "zod": "^3.24.2" + "zod": "^4.0.10" }, "devDependencies": { "@aws-sdk/types": "3.775.0", @@ -650,15 +650,6 @@ "node": ">=16.0.0" } }, - "node_modules/@aws-amplify/backend-output-schemas": { - "version": "1.7.0", - "resolved": "https://registry.npmjs.org/@aws-amplify/backend-output-schemas/-/backend-output-schemas-1.7.0.tgz", - "integrity": "sha512-EZJJYXtMJR2gIJGVRWVopAHrIzb3EshBac3MTAoMi1nmavvsvBoQTo6df1VhqCbCwPXtW2J5j+iKvD7b5AKYmg==", - "license": "Apache-2.0", - "peerDependencies": { - "zod": "3.25.17" - } - }, "node_modules/@aws-amplify/client-config": { "version": "1.8.0", "resolved": "https://registry.npmjs.org/@aws-amplify/client-config/-/client-config-1.8.0.tgz", @@ -678,6 +669,24 @@ "@aws-sdk/client-s3": "^3.750.0" } }, + "node_modules/@aws-amplify/client-config/node_modules/@aws-amplify/backend-output-schemas": { + "version": "1.7.0", + "resolved": "https://registry.npmjs.org/@aws-amplify/backend-output-schemas/-/backend-output-schemas-1.7.0.tgz", + "integrity": "sha512-EZJJYXtMJR2gIJGVRWVopAHrIzb3EshBac3MTAoMi1nmavvsvBoQTo6df1VhqCbCwPXtW2J5j+iKvD7b5AKYmg==", + "license": "Apache-2.0", + "peerDependencies": { + "zod": "3.25.17" + } + }, + "node_modules/@aws-amplify/client-config/node_modules/zod": { + "version": "3.25.17", + "resolved": "https://registry.npmjs.org/zod/-/zod-3.25.17.tgz", + "integrity": "sha512-8hQzQ/kMOIFbwOgPrm9Sf9rtFHpFUMy4HvN0yEB0spw14aYi0uT5xG5CE2DB9cd51GWNsz+DNO7se1kztHMKnw==", + "license": "MIT", + "funding": { + "url": "https://github.com/sponsors/colinhacks" + } + }, "node_modules/@aws-amplify/core": { "version": "6.12.0", "resolved": "https://registry.npmjs.org/@aws-amplify/core/-/core-6.12.0.tgz", @@ -856,6 +865,24 @@ "@aws-sdk/types": "^3.734.0" } }, + "node_modules/@aws-amplify/deployed-backend-client/node_modules/@aws-amplify/backend-output-schemas": { + "version": "1.7.0", + "resolved": "https://registry.npmjs.org/@aws-amplify/backend-output-schemas/-/backend-output-schemas-1.7.0.tgz", + "integrity": "sha512-EZJJYXtMJR2gIJGVRWVopAHrIzb3EshBac3MTAoMi1nmavvsvBoQTo6df1VhqCbCwPXtW2J5j+iKvD7b5AKYmg==", + "license": "Apache-2.0", + "peerDependencies": { + "zod": "3.25.17" + } + }, + "node_modules/@aws-amplify/deployed-backend-client/node_modules/zod": { + "version": "3.25.17", + "resolved": "https://registry.npmjs.org/zod/-/zod-3.25.17.tgz", + "integrity": "sha512-8hQzQ/kMOIFbwOgPrm9Sf9rtFHpFUMy4HvN0yEB0spw14aYi0uT5xG5CE2DB9cd51GWNsz+DNO7se1kztHMKnw==", + "license": "MIT", + "funding": { + "url": "https://github.com/sponsors/colinhacks" + } + }, "node_modules/@aws-amplify/graphql-directives": { "version": "1.1.0", "resolved": "https://registry.npmjs.org/@aws-amplify/graphql-directives/-/graphql-directives-1.1.0.tgz", @@ -974,6 +1001,25 @@ "@aws-sdk/client-cloudformation": "^3.750.0" } }, + "node_modules/@aws-amplify/model-generator/node_modules/@aws-amplify/backend-output-schemas": { + "version": "1.7.0", + "resolved": "https://registry.npmjs.org/@aws-amplify/backend-output-schemas/-/backend-output-schemas-1.7.0.tgz", + "integrity": "sha512-EZJJYXtMJR2gIJGVRWVopAHrIzb3EshBac3MTAoMi1nmavvsvBoQTo6df1VhqCbCwPXtW2J5j+iKvD7b5AKYmg==", + "license": "Apache-2.0", + "peerDependencies": { + "zod": "3.25.17" + } + }, + "node_modules/@aws-amplify/model-generator/node_modules/zod": { + "version": "3.25.17", + "resolved": "https://registry.npmjs.org/zod/-/zod-3.25.17.tgz", + "integrity": "sha512-8hQzQ/kMOIFbwOgPrm9Sf9rtFHpFUMy4HvN0yEB0spw14aYi0uT5xG5CE2DB9cd51GWNsz+DNO7se1kztHMKnw==", + "license": "MIT", + "peer": true, + "funding": { + "url": "https://github.com/sponsors/colinhacks" + } + }, "node_modules/@aws-amplify/notifications": { "version": "2.0.81", "resolved": "https://registry.npmjs.org/@aws-amplify/notifications/-/notifications-2.0.81.tgz", @@ -1049,6 +1095,15 @@ "uuid": "dist/esm/bin/uuid" } }, + "node_modules/@aws-amplify/platform-core/node_modules/zod": { + "version": "3.25.17", + "resolved": "https://registry.npmjs.org/zod/-/zod-3.25.17.tgz", + "integrity": "sha512-8hQzQ/kMOIFbwOgPrm9Sf9rtFHpFUMy4HvN0yEB0spw14aYi0uT5xG5CE2DB9cd51GWNsz+DNO7se1kztHMKnw==", + "license": "MIT", + "funding": { + "url": "https://github.com/sponsors/colinhacks" + } + }, "node_modules/@aws-amplify/plugin-types": { "version": "1.10.1", "resolved": "https://registry.npmjs.org/@aws-amplify/plugin-types/-/plugin-types-1.10.1.tgz", @@ -37617,9 +37672,9 @@ } }, "node_modules/zod": { - "version": "3.25.17", - "resolved": "https://registry.npmjs.org/zod/-/zod-3.25.17.tgz", - "integrity": "sha512-8hQzQ/kMOIFbwOgPrm9Sf9rtFHpFUMy4HvN0yEB0spw14aYi0uT5xG5CE2DB9cd51GWNsz+DNO7se1kztHMKnw==", + "version": "4.0.10", + "resolved": "https://registry.npmjs.org/zod/-/zod-4.0.10.tgz", + "integrity": "sha512-3vB+UU3/VmLL2lvwcY/4RV2i9z/YU0DTV/tDuYjrwmx5WeJ7hwy+rGEEx8glHp6Yxw7ibRbKSaIFBgReRPe5KA==", "license": "MIT", "funding": { "url": "https://github.com/sponsors/colinhacks"